Output 084ae2194bd8b4a4af851a19ddf29cb82894014597f8087f25ee244efe65cc58:3

value
639369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a15ab97b88dc80977c2408e15433301b2297ba OP_EQUAL
address
37mKpJbxjkx7zpwNde8fW9hw8EUHjEvcaK
transaction
084ae2194bd8b4a4af851a19ddf29cb82894014597f8087f25ee244efe65cc58
spent
true